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Компьютеры » Программы » Inno Setup (создание инсталяционных пакетов)

Модерирует : gyra, Maz

Widok (10-08-2009 22:13): Лимит страниц. Продолжаем здесь.  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146

   

Widok



Moderator-Следопыт
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Это мощное бесплатное средство для создания установочных пакетов (дистрибутивов) программ. Поддерживается шифрование, установка пароля, различные задачи по завершении установки.
По сравнению с NSIS (основной конкурент на бесплатной основе) проще в настройке, имеет более понятную структуру скрипта, но генерит на 200-300 кб больший инсталятор. На данный момент он конкурирует и даже превосходит многие коммерческие установщики по функциональности и стабильности.
 
Последний бета релиз: 5.3.3 [05.08.2009]
Последний стабильный релиз: 5.2.4 [01.04.2009]
Что нового? | Что нового в версии 5.3-beta? | Все сборки
 
Inno Setup Compiler 5.2.3 090506 - расширенная версия от ResTools (зеркало)
Добавляет списку компонентов возможность сворачивать дочерние элементы. Содержит более удобный редактор, кроме того, компилятор имеет множество других возможностей и новых функций. На сайте автора также есть дополнительные библиотеки.
 
Русификатор версии 5.3.2 от vadimsva
 
Русская справка к версии 5.0.x, автор перевода BagIra (зеркало) | cкачать в .chm формате
 
Inno Setup Scripting 5.1 - Руководство по расширенным возможностям Inno Setup от Kindly
версия 5 скачать (зеркало) | версия 4 скачать (зеркало) | версия 3 скачать (зеркало)
 
Inno Setup Extensions Knowledge Base (содержит ответы на многие вопросы) | старая chm-версия
 
 

Дополнительные библиотеки и примеры для Inno Setup - Corona Skin, InnoTools Downloader, распаковка архивов 7-zip и FreeArc и т.д.
 
Дополнительные утилиты для Inno Setup - сюда входят различные распаковщики, надстройки над Inno Setup, различные генераторы скриптов, утилита объединения скриптов и т.д.
 
Пережатиe/Pекомпрессия/Oптимизация файлов для лучшего сжатия - обсуждение того, какими утилитами/способами лучше сжимать, чтобы получить как можно меньший размер инсталятора.
 

Примечание для всех участников

 
Перед тем, как задать вопрос: загрузите "версию для печати" (ссылка справа вверху, над номерами страниц) и попробуйте поискать средствами браузера (ctrl+F). Большинство типовых задач уже решались, причем неоднократно!
 
ВНИМАНИЕ!

Текст всех программ обязательно заключайте в теги [code][/code].
Большие тексты (более 10 строк) обязательно прячутся в [more]ВАШ ТЕКСТ и/или Ваш КОД[/more]


мусор вынесен в пост

Всего записей: 24190 | Зарегистр. 07-04-2002 | Отправлено: 12:45 16-05-2009 | Исправлено: SotM, 12:44 09-08-2009
Gocha1



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Короче, вы хот раз запустите крипт ФриАрка на версию 5.3.2 (Ю)
 

 
Вот оно где ругается на юникодовом инно, если поставить ";", то архив не берет

Всего записей: 259 | Зарегистр. 26-10-2007 | Отправлено: 14:23 29-07-2009 | Исправлено: Gocha1, 14:29 29-07-2009
Artem_Butenko



Advanced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Цитата:
Ребята, пожалуйста помогите реализовать в "тихом инсталляторе" (в котором путь установки извлекается из ключа системного реестра) такую идею: если ключ системного реестра с параметром Path не найден, должно появиться диалоговое окно выбора директории назначения (т.е., то, что появляется при нажатии кнопки "Обзор"), где необходимо указать конечный каталог. Дальше установка продолжится по-прежнему в "тихом режиме". Я знаю, как подобные действия организовать в NSIS, а вот в Inno Setup для меня проблема. Буду рад Вашей помощи!

 Уже третий день мучаюсь над скриптом. Может быть раньше, кто-нибудь пробывал решать подобную задачу? Часто, такое можно увидеть в патчерах на NSIS.

Всего записей: 711 | Зарегистр. 19-02-2008 | Отправлено: 14:25 29-07-2009 | Исправлено: Artem_Butenko, 14:30 29-07-2009
Bulat_Ziganshin

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Слайд-шоу в окне инсталляции
Скрипт для вывода данных о винтах
Описания компонентов
Запрет установки в папку Windows
Улучшенный деинсталлятор
Поиск нужных файлов
Добавление чекбокса Подробнее...
добавить изображение под кнопкой "Обзор" Подробнее...
Скрипт для установки кистей в Фотошоп
при инсталяции запускаемому файлу и его ярлыкам автоматически задавалась опция "Режим совместимости с Вин98"?
http://forum.ru-board.com/topic.cgi?forum=5&topic=30413&start=2060#5
кликабельная текстовая http-ссылка в левом нижнем углу инсталлера
пример текстурирования кнопок скрипт+bmp(rapidshare.com) скрипт
способ, которым можно скрыть любую страницу Подробнее... можно избавиться от страницы приветствия.
бекап файлов http://forum.ru-board.com/topic.cgi?forum=5&topic=30413&start=2260#16 способ от New_KoMa
использование GameuxInstallHelper.dll на примере Call of Juarez - Bound in Blood скрипт
пример использования библиотеки FirewallInstallHelper.dll (важно! нашел в версии для печати скрипт
пути к стандартным папкам Windows независимо от локализации системы скрипт
 
 
скрипты инсталляторов для игр


Prototype
Вот кому нужен тот же скрипт, но доработанный, теперь отображаются файлы которые в данный момент извлекаются.
Хотел сделать проценты установки, но через AfterInstall если большие файлы, то проценты апдейдятся долго. Если кто знает, подскажите пожалуйста. (Shegorat)
Подробнее...
 
Вот еще скрипт Прототипа, присутствует ReadyPage, LicensePage, ProgrammGroupPage
http://forum.ru-board.com/topic.cgi?forum=5&topic=30413&start=2220#10
(Shegorat)

Всего записей: 3401 | Зарегистр. 13-08-2007 | Отправлено: 14:54 29-07-2009
bush1

Newbie
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Подскажите надо ли предварительно сжимать freearc-ом элементы игры или надо в скрипте путь указвать папкам которые надо сжать им же.

Всего записей: 26 | Зарегистр. 27-07-2009 | Отправлено: 14:56 29-07-2009
Bulat_Ziganshin

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Цитата:
надо ли предварительно сжимать freearc-ом элементы игры

да

Всего записей: 3401 | Зарегистр. 13-08-2007 | Отправлено: 14:59 29-07-2009
Smit13

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Помогите пожалуйста , если у кого есть дайте пожалуйста готовый скрипт где собраны вместе эти функции:  
http://forum.ru-board.com/topic.cgi?forum=5&topic=30239&start=0&limit=1&m=2#1 [?] [?] [?] [?]  и  
Библиотека для распаковки 7zip архивов с отображением прогресс бара в окне Inno Setup.  
 
Так чтобы при нсталяции архив распаковался и файл PCF преобразовался в исходный файл , у меня не получается сделать чтоб всё это работало.  
Никто не знает как это сделать?

Всего записей: 98 | Зарегистр. 15-07-2009 | Отправлено: 15:12 29-07-2009
Bulat_Ziganshin

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
создал на свёом сайте страницу с разлчиными версиями скрипта: http://freearc.org/ru/InnoSetup.aspx и занёс её в шапку

Всего записей: 3401 | Зарегистр. 13-08-2007 | Отправлено: 15:47 29-07-2009
A19EXXX



Full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Цитата:
Скажите, судя по этому скрипту (вариант 1), все файлы .pcf (даже те, которые в под-папках) папки Data должны преобразоваться в исходный формат, или только файлы папки Data, без под-папковых файлов?

Всего записей: 513 | Зарегистр. 02-07-2009 | Отправлено: 16:27 29-07-2009
LonerDergunov



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Помогите в  первый скрипт Prototype от Shegorat из шапки темы добавить кнопку с http-ссылкой вот такую:
Подробнее...
 
Или же кликабельную текстовую http-ссылку в левом нижнем углу инсталлера.
 
Вставляю фрагменты этих скриптов в соответстующие секции скрипта Prototype - в результате при компиляции выходит ошибка Out of Memory.

Всего записей: 2972 | Зарегистр. 11-07-2007 | Отправлено: 17:43 29-07-2009
A19EXXX



Full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
1) Можно ли сделать, чтобы картинка в левом нижнем углу была на всех страницах, кроме страницы распаковки??? (т.к. использую скрипт слайд-шоу из шапки)
 
2) Как указать вручную, сколько нужно места для распаковки файлов??

Всего записей: 513 | Зарегистр. 02-07-2009 | Отправлено: 18:00 29-07-2009
SotM



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
Gocha1
Не увеличивай шрифт, ты тут не рекламу развешиваешь. Обычным шрифтом всё хорошо видно. На другом форуме тебя возможно уже бы забанили для профилактики.
 
A19EXXX
Эта ветка форума посвящена чему?! Правильно Inno Setup, а ты про что спрашиваешь? Как пользоваться FreeArc'ом! Если у меня задний переклюк на велике не работает, мне тоже здесь спрашивать? Для этого есть другие форумы, Google, и т.д.
 
Bulat_Ziganshin
Хорошо что хоть ты вынес лишний мусор в отдельную пост. Хоть меньше трафика будет уходить на загрузку каждой страницы.
 
2ALL
Думаю собраться с мыслями и написать небольшой MiniFAQ. Как думаете, что туда нужно включить? Я хочу его сделать в виде .chm файла (как только разберусь как это сделать). Большая коллекция скриптов НЕ будет включена туда, т.к. это коллекция и пускай будет отдельно. Может кто нибудь захочет обновить и коллекцию скриптов из шапки?

Всего записей: 965 | Зарегистр. 28-11-2006 | Отправлено: 18:14 29-07-2009
A19EXXX



Full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
SotM, беса не гони, причём здесь вообще FreeArc???

Всего записей: 513 | Зарегистр. 02-07-2009 | Отправлено: 19:02 29-07-2009
Bulat_Ziganshin

Silver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Версия 3.0 скрипта для FreeArc
; Изменения от Bulat Ziganshin, 29-07-2009
;   - функция ArchiveOrigSize возвращает объём данных в архиве
;   - наименования колбэков изменены на read и write (было progress и written)
 

Всего записей: 3401 | Зарегистр. 13-08-2007 | Отправлено: 19:17 29-07-2009 | Исправлено: Bulat_Ziganshin, 19:26 29-07-2009
Roden37101



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
повторюсь, но всё же...
насчёт скрипта для FreeArc  
нельзя ли сделать так,
если второго архива нет на диске то выводилось сообщение с просьбой вставить второй диск  (как с инно при разделении на части).

Всего записей: 194 | Зарегистр. 20-06-2009 | Отправлено: 19:23 29-07-2009
Gocha1



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Где могу найти такой вариант... после нажатия Завершить открывается веб-страница, и после закрытие запускается игра
 
Добавлено:

Цитата:
насчёт скрипта для FreeArc  
нельзя ли сделать так,  
если второго архива нет на диске то выводилось сообщение с просьбой вставить второй диск  (как с инно при разделении на части).

тоже интересно

Всего записей: 259 | Зарегистр. 26-10-2007 | Отправлено: 20:34 29-07-2009 | Исправлено: Gocha1, 20:39 29-07-2009
Smit13

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Мне никто не ответит

Всего записей: 98 | Зарегистр. 15-07-2009 | Отправлено: 20:41 29-07-2009
Roden37101



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
SotM

Цитата:
Как думаете, что туда нужно включить?

думаю часть мусора убранного из шапки, а именно
 
Слайд-шоу в окне инсталляции
Добавление чекбокса  
пример текстурирования кнопок

Всего записей: 194 | Зарегистр. 20-06-2009 | Отправлено: 21:09 29-07-2009
vlad1996

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
"кликабельная текстовая http-ссылка в левом нижнем углу инсталлера"
 
Как сделать так что-бы там была не надпись а картинка?
 

Всего записей: 49 | Зарегистр. 27-07-2009 | Отправлено: 21:53 29-07-2009 | Исправлено: vlad1996, 21:54 29-07-2009
A19EXXX



Full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
vlad1996, поиск юзай, было не раз....

Всего записей: 513 | Зарегистр. 02-07-2009 | Отправлено: 22:05 29-07-2009
SotM



Advanced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
vlad1996
А поискать по форуму не ужто сложно?! Или нужно чтобы всё было на тарелочке предложено?
 
A19EXXX
А это к чему относится?!

Цитата:
Скажите, судя по этому скрипту (вариант 1), все файлы .pcf (даже те, которые в под-папках) папки Data должны преобразоваться в исходный формат, или только файлы папки Data, без под-папковых файлов?

 
Roden37101
Я их не смотрел еще. Тоесть сами скрипты туда должны быть включены? Или быть может эти скрипты включить отдельно и именно в коллекцию скриптов?

Всего записей: 965 | Зарегистр. 28-11-2006 | Отправлено: 22:08 29-07-2009
   

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146

Компьютерный форум Ru.Board » Компьютеры » Программы » Inno Setup (создание инсталяционных пакетов)
Widok (10-08-2009 22:13): Лимит страниц. Продолжаем здесь.


Реклама на форуме Ru.Board.

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
Modified by Ru.B0ard
© Ru.B0ard 2000-2024

B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

Рейтинг.ru